driving test results e-mail

  • 02-07-2013 10:58pm
    #1
    Registered Users Posts: 1


    I did my test today and I noticed that I was sent an email saying I had failed 10 minutes before I even started the test. I checked for the e-mail for the last test I did aswell and it was also received 10 minutes before my test started. Could anybody else that did their test recently check what time they received the results by e-mail, thanks.

  • Registered Users, Registered Users 2 Posts: 348 ✭✭Motor-Ed


    Faith+1 wrote: »
    They don't use the old coloured marking sheet anymore?

    No you get this first with the error section ,just circled, eg , position on straights, without detailing how many faults or what grade.

    https://www.dropbox.com/s/1yb0p0i0y2wr5as/Final%20Version%20Driving%20Test%20Feedback%20Form.pdf


    Depending on what way you applied you then get this by email or snailmail, could be a week later?.....?
    Basically instructors are not happy with it
